引言:
TPWallet(以下简称钱包)作为数字资产载体,其安全性不能仅看客户端界面或签名流程,而应从交易分析、核心加密创新、备份策略、市场环境、身份验证和找回机制等多维度审视。以下为逐项深入分析与建议。
1. 高级支付分析(Advanced Payment Analysis)
要点:链上链下数据整合、行为指纹、风险评分和合规审计。钱包若集成或依赖第三方分析,能在交易前后识别异常转账、智能合约风险或可疑地址聚类,降低被钓鱼或洗钱利用的概率。但同时,高级分析会削弱用户隐私,且若分析模型被攻破,可能导致误判或滥用。
建议:选择可配置的分析级别、透明的隐私策略、在本地优先做风险评估并仅在必要时上报最少数据,支持用户自定义风控阈值和白名单。
2. 高科技领域创新
要点:多方计算(MPC)、阈值签名、TEE/安全元件(SE)、硬件钱包集成、零知识证明(ZKP)和去中心化身份(DID)等能显著提升钥匙管理与交易签名安全。MPC可在不暴露私钥的前提下实现在线签名;ZKP可在合规场景下证明交易合规性而不泄露细节。
建议:优先采用开源与经审计的加密库,提供硬件隔离选项,逐步引入阈签与社交恢复模组,并对新技术做持续渗透测试与第三方审计。
3. 资产备份

要点:传统助记词单点备份高风险,需支持多样化备份方案:离线硬件冷备份、分片(Shamir)、加密云备份与社会恢复。备份必须兼顾可恢复性与抗盗性。
建议:默认引导用户生成安全备份方案(例如 2-of-3 多重备份:硬件、加密云、社交恢复),在备份链路上使用强加密与设备绑定,并提供恢复演练工具以降低人为错误。
4. 新兴市场机遇
要点:在移动优先、身份基础薄弱的区域,钱包能通过轻量化 SDK、低费用链路、离线签名与本地法币通道打开用户入口。跨境汇款、微支付与链上合规金融服务是重要场景。
建议:提供多语言、本地合规指引、低带宽模式与与本地支付提供商合作的法币通道;注意合规与隐私平衡,避免在监管不清晰地区暴露用户数据。
5. 高级身份验证

要点:单纯密码不够,推荐结合硬件 MFA(WebAuthn/FIDO2)、生物识别(受限于设备安全)与行为分析。设备指纹与远程证明(attestation)能减少被克隆设备的风险。
建议:采用以公钥为中心的身份体系,优先支持硬件键与系统安全模块,生物识别作为便捷二次因素,并允许用户备选 MFA 设备以保证可用性。
6. 账户找回
要点:找回往往是安全与可用性的冲突点。完全无恢复(non-custodial)用户若丢失私钥会永久失去资产;而弱找回机制会引入社会工程风险。
建议:提供多种找回路径:智能合约社会恢复(guardian)、阈签备份、受监管的托管/半托管选项以及法定 KYC+法律渠道作为最后手段。对每种机制强调风险告知并提供可视化恢复流程和多重确认。
结论:
TPWallet 的安全不能依赖单一技术,而应构建多层防御:本地优先的隐私保护、可审计的加密与签名技术、多样化且可演练的备份与恢复方案、灵活的 MFA,以及在新兴市场慎重设计合规与用户体验的平衡。定期第三方审计、红蓝对抗、公开安全报告与透明的漏洞赏金计划是维持长期可信赖性的必要措施。
评论
Alex
很全面的分析,尤其赞同把备份和社会恢复结合起来的建议。
小明
能否再详细说说 MPC 和阈签在移动钱包中的实现代价?
CryptoFan88
关于合规与隐私的平衡写得很好,期待作者出一篇落地的实施指南。
李娜
建议里提到的恢复演练工具有没有现成的开源方案推荐?
SatoshiJunior
如果钱包支持硬件安全模块但用户手机丢了,找回流程的安全性如何保证?很想看到具体流程示例。